Transaction 218516faf17613fe56fa61f4cf873c4e920a8c122718d5ad61ba42d3572da56f
1 Input
2 Outputs
- 218516faf17613fe56fa61f4cf873c4e920a8c122718d5ad61ba42d3572da56f:0
- 218516faf17613fe56fa61f4cf873c4e920a8c122718d5ad61ba42d3572da56f:1
value 149231000
address 34jF1DzxmxLc6wWP28YnoSdgrfp5A3tEqY
value 399991771
address bc1p9g4r3xandlmw2lra0mf9p0yxw54fdnleyykdfzxk205pku884w3sxxp372